SHIPMENT Lewis: Let's have a word about delivery under FOB terms, shall we? Xiong: I have not the slightest objection. Lewis: As buyers, you are to charter a ship or book the shipping space. Xiong: That's understood. Lewis: Then you should advise us by cable name of ship and its sailing date. Xiong: That's also understood. Will you make clear to me your responsibility? Lewis: We'll see the goods pass over the ship's rail and our responsibility ends there. Xiong: You should bear all the costs of transportation of the goods, shouldn't you? Lewis: Yes, we bear all the charges up to the time the goods are on the hooks. Xiong: What do you mean by all the charges? Lewis: They are Customs duties, as well as any service charges on exporting goods. Xiong: As I understand it, you are also to inform us of the contract number, name of commodity, quantity, loading port and the estimated date when the goods will reach the port of loading. Am I right? Lewis: Yes. We'll cable you 30 days before the month of shipment. Xiong: Excellent. So far we have a mutual under standing on everything concerning our respective responsibilities. I hope we'll both discharge then as well.
